College Opportunity Fund Working Group
Summary
The bill creates a working group to make findings and recommendations concerning how to implement the college opportunity fund for persons who are incarcerated in Colorado, including whether fee-for-service contracts for participating institutions of higher education need to be modified. The bill requires the working group to report its findings and recommendations to the education committees of the house of representatives and the senate on or before December 1, 2026.(Note: This summary applies to this bill as introduced.)
